▸ Daria Dugina, 29, died instantly when the car bomb exploded on the outskirts of Moscow on Saturday. But the act is believed to have been aimed at her father Alexanr Dugin, 60, who before departure chose another car. The fascist ideologue has been called “Putin’s brain” and is said to be close to the Russian president. The murder of Daria Dugina has sparked outrage in Russia, and representatives of the country were quick to point to Ukraine as responsible.
